The Toyota Land Cruiser is a robust and versatile SUV, well-suited for Kenyan conditions, particularly for those who frequently travel upcountry or require a reliable family vehicle with off-road capabilities. With a strong presence in the Kenyan market, it is popular among business executives, government officials, and adventure seekers. The Land Cruiser's reputation for durability and comfort makes it a top choice for long-distance travel and rough terrains.
The Land Cruiser is renowned for its durability and longevity, often exceeding 300,000 km with proper maintenance. Diesel engines require regular injector and turbo inspections, while petrol engines are generally more forgiving. The robust suspension handles rough roads well, though bushings and shock absorbers may need attention over time.
Regular maintenance is crucial, with oil changes recommended every 5,000 to 7,500 km. Diesel engines may incur higher maintenance costs due to injector and turbo care. Parts are generally available, but genuine components can be pricey. The automatic transmission requires periodic fluid checks to ensure longevity.
Spare parts are widely available in Nairobi's Industrial Area and Kirinyaga Road, with genuine parts accessible through Toyota's authorized service centers. Aftermarket options are plentiful, though caution is advised to avoid counterfeit parts. Ex-Japan spares are a viable option for cost savings.
Diesel variants, typically using the 1VD-FTV 4.5L V8, offer better fuel economy on highways but can be thirsty in city traffic. Petrol models, often equipped with the 4.6L V8, provide smoother power delivery but at the cost of higher fuel consumption, especially in urban settings.
